FAQ about MIDI THRU Box (THRU-6/THRU-3)

Q:Can one MIDI signal go in and be distributed to 6 devices to receive at the same time?

A:Yes, you can.

Q:Is the product delayed?

  • There is no delay, the product uses hardware shunt, high-speed without delay.

Q:Can the THRU-6 be powered directly through the MIDI IN port?

A:Yes, but if there are too many devices connected to the MIDI output of the THRU-6, or the MIDI cable is too long, it will cause

The transmission is unstable, so it is recommended to determine whether to supply power to the THRU-6 through the USB-B interface according to the actual situation.

Q:Can USB-B connect to a computer to communicate MIDI?

A:No, USB-B is used to power the THRU-6 without MIDI communication.

Q:Can the MIDI OUT (MIDI THRU) of the THRU-6 supply power to MIDI devices?

A:It can provide 5V power supply, but the power supply is not high. If the external MIDI device requires high power, it is recommended to supply additional power.

Q:Delay or packet loss occurs when connecting multiple MIDI THRU ports

A:Please check the THRU-6 and the external MIDI equipment, whether the power supply is normal; check whether the MIDI cable is firm.

Q:Some MIDI OUT (MIDI THRU) cannot communicate, or the connected device does not respond

A:THRU-6 does not change the MIDI communication content, please check whether the MIDI channel settings of the input and output MIDI devices are consistent.
